Suja Juice Joins Forces with Coca-Cola
Suja Life LLC, San Diego, CA, announced an investment and distribution partnership with The Coca-Cola Company, Atlanta, GA. Coca-Cola's minority investment will increase the availability of Suja, moving the brand closer to achieving its mission of “democratizing organic, cold-pressured juice.”
The Coca‑Cola Company will begin distributing Suja through the Odwalla chilled direct store delivery system. In addition, the Merchant Banking Division of Goldman Sachs has made a minority investment in Suja. The company said the closing of these deals provides Suja with the expertise and accessibility to further increase product distribution and operational efficiencies, as well as the ability to expand its manufacturing facilities to increase capacity in response to growing demand.
"When we started our home-delivery juicing company in San Diego about three years ago, we couldn't have imagined the incredible growth and consumer demand that we face today," said Jeff Church, co-founder and CEO of Suja. "As we continued to innovate and find ways to democratize juice, we soon realized that for us to take the business to the next level in providing organic, cold-pressured juice to even more people, we needed to find the correct strategic partners. As these new partnerships begin, nothing will change in Suja's promise to its fans: our juice will always be organic, non-GMO, cold-pressured, and free of any additives."
